Dahi Fry / Dahi Tadka – Naush Special
Author:
Naush
Ingredients
Yogurt 1 cup
Oil 2-3 tbsp
Dried red chili
long or round 2
Bay leaves 2
Cumin seeds 1/2 tsp
Onion 1 small
thickly sliced
Green chili 1
Garlic clove 1
Ginger 1 inch
Salt to taste
Turmeric powder 1/2 tsp
Kashmiri red chili powder 1/2 tsp
or red chili powder for extra heat
Garam masala 1/2 tsp
Coriander powder 1/2 tsp
Instructions
Whisk yogurt until smooth and lump free. Keep aside.
Chop together green chili, garlic and ginger in a hand chopper or grater. Keep aside.
In a pan, add oil, red chilies, bay leaves and cumin seeds, fry on low until aromatic.
Add chopped veggies and sauté until the raw smell of ginger and garlic goes away.
Add onions and sauté until the onions are translucent but still crunchy. Crunchy texture gives nice taste to the dahi fry.
Now add salt, turmeric powder, Kashmiri red chili powder, garam masala and coriander powder. Sauté for 30 seconds on low heat and turn the flame off.
Add this mixture to the whisked yogurt and mix well.
Dahi fry is ready.
Enjoy with your favorite paratha, naan or rice dish!
